Transaction 9671fa3768f7a7159ed545389e0aafe188930c95327a5f4a50f0a0182011b7cd
1 Input
1 Output
-
9671fa3768f7a7159ed545389e0aafe188930c95327a5f4a50f0a0182011b7cd:0
- value
- 2447863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d893846ecd68b391b1ad456c5d45965cdcedc47 OP_EQUAL
- address
- 3BgBxeuWumRmyV1ARDcotijh6wqcth4oqz